Earlier Dopaminergic Treatment in Parkinson's Disease Is Not Associated With Improved Outcomes

BACKGROUND: The appropriate timing of dopaminergic treatment initiation in Parkinson's disease (PD) remains a matter of debate. The primary objective of this study was to determine whether earlier initiation of treatment was associated with less worsening of total UPDRS scores over 48 months. M...
